Balancing the dual responsibilities of working from home and managing household duties as a stay-at-home mom (SAHM) can be both rewarding and challenging. Many moms find that having a job that allows them to work off the phone offers flexibility and helps maintain focus amidst family demands. However, this balance often requires careful planning and support. It's important to acknowledge that caregiving plays a crucial role in this dynamic. Relying on a caregiver can provide essential relief, enabling moms to concentrate on their professional tasks during work hours. Whether the job demands full-time attention or allows part-time engagement makes a significant difference in how to organize the day. Another aspect is recognizing the importance of setting boundaries between work and home life. Developing clear routines, scheduled breaks to attend to family needs, and dedicated spaces for work can improve efficiency and reduce stress. Finally, technology and remote work tools are invaluable assets for work-from-home moms. Utilizing applications for communication, task management, and time tracking can facilitate smoother workflows while ensuring that family commitments are not neglected. By combining effective caregiving, structured work schedules, community support, and appropriate use of technology, moms navigating the intersection of work-from-home and stay-at-home roles can create a balanced, fulfilling lifestyle.
